RE: The tariff classification of a child’s card-decorating activity kit from China.

Dear Mr. Maher:

In your letter dated April 4, 2006, you requested a tariff classification ruling on behalf of Rose Art Industries, Inc.

A sample identified as a Scrapfabulous “My Designer Cards” kit (Item # 5835) was submitted for our examination and is being returned to you as requested. Designed to allow a child to make personalized greeting cards, the kit consists of ten unfinished cards accompanied by a number of items to be used in decorating and presenting them. All of the goods are packed together in a printed paperboard retail display box.

Five of the cards are scored, folded sheets of paperboard, 5” x 7” in closed condition, with a blank interior. The exterior, which appears to be coated, is printed with a repetitive design, and the front panel incorporates a large, decoratively shaped cutout. The other five cards are smaller (2” x 3” when closed) and do not incorporate cutouts. The accompanying items are as follows: 5 paper envelopes that will accommodate the large cards, 3 gel pens, a small bag of “3-D embellishments” (bits of plastic foam, etc.), assorted printed paper stickers, a small bag of “star confetti,” a “journaling template” (plastic stencil cut with alphabet letters and numerals), a glue stick, a short length of multicolored cord, and an instruction sheet.

For tariff classification purposes, the kit will be regarded as “goods put up in sets for retail sale” whose essential character is imparted by the large paperboard cards, which provide a focal point for the suggested activity.

The applicable subheading for the complete # 5835 Scrapfabulous “My Designer Cards” kit will be 4823.90.6600,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for other (non-enumerated) articles of coated paper or paperboard. The rate of duty will be Free.
